Armenia heirs win $17m Axa payout

The descendants of Armenians who died in mass killings by Ottoman Turks have agreed to settle a class-action lawsuit against French insurance giant Axa.

The case, filed in California, accused Axa of failing to pay death benefits on policies bought by Armenians who died.

Under the deal, the firm will pay $17m (£9.7m) to Armenian charitable groups.

Armenians say 1.5m of their people were killed or deported under Ottoman Turkish rule in 1915. Turkey denies there was a systematic massacre.
